A System for Incident Detection in Urban Traffic Networks
This paper presents the formulation of a system for incident detection in urban traffic networks. The system uses cumulative detector readings from three detectors along the upstream approaches of intersections to identify incidents along various approach sections. A system prototype was developed and tested in a simulation environment under various incident scenarios. Results on the effectiveness of the proposed system to detect incidents causing different blockage conditions are presented.
